Surrey County Cricket Club Academy complete pre-season training camp at Desert Springs Resort

 

Nine (9) members of the Surrey County Cricket Club Academy accompanied by three (3) coaching staff, are now back in England having completed a successful 4-day training camp between Saturday 16th – Wednesday 20th February at Desert Springs Resort, Europe’s only international award-winning luxury family resort and championship desert golf course with its very own dedicated Cricket Ground and Academy, in the Almanzora region of Almeria, Andalucía in south-east Spain.

Grass net practice, both bowling and batting, Out-field practice, strength and conditioning work, running, speed and agility work all took place at the Cricket Academy. The squad utilised the Gym at the Sierra Sports Club for specific fitness sessions.

The players and coaches were accommodated in some of the privately-owned apartments reserved for holidays and short breaks at Desert Springs and the resort’s executive chef was on hand to cater for the special dietary requirements of individual players dining in El Torrente Restaurant.
